How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shriners?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Shriners Studio Apartments | $1,187 | $825 | $1,795 |
| Shriners 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,245 | $810 | $3,237 |
| Shriners 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,664 | $910 | $5,099 |
| Shriners 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,534 | $815 | $2,122 |
| Shriners 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,000 | $1,000 | $1,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Shriners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Shriners with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Shriners is at BelleFontaine Apartment Homes listed at $685.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Shriners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Shriners is $1,187.
What is the largest available Studio Shriners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Shriners is a 622 square feet unit starting from $1,700 at The Landing at Lakewood Harbour.
What is the average size for Shriners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Shriners is currently 500 sq ft.
